UPP, the UK's leading provider of on-campus residential and academic accommodation infrastructure, invites applications for a Sustainability Project Coordinator. Join the Energy & ESG team to deliver sustainability initiatives, energy and carbon reduction across our national portfolio. You'll coordinate projects with the Director of Energy & ESG, ESG Analyst, operations teams and university partners, embedding sustainability into day-to-day operations and driving meaningful environmental impact.
